Blair County, Pennsylvania has 5 power plants totaling 252 MW of nameplate capacity. Browse every plant below with fuel type, operator, and capacity.
| Plant | City | Fuel | Capacity | Operator |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Sandy Ridge Wind 2, Llc | Tyrone | Wind | 87.6 MW | Algonquin Power Co |
| North Allegheny Windpower Project | Lilly | Wind | 75.0 MW | Duke Energy Renewables Services |
| Sandy Ridge Wind Farm | Tyrone | Wind | 50.0 MW | Algonquin Power Co |
| Chestnut Flats Wind Farm | Altoona | Wind | 38.0 MW | Edf Renewable Asset Holdings, Inc. |
| Juniata Locomotive Shop | Altoona | Natural Gas | 1.5 MW | Norfork Southern Corp |
Blair County, Pennsylvania has 5 power plants totaling 252 MW of nameplate capacity. Wind is the dominant fuel source at 99% of installed capacity, followed by Natural Gas (1%). The largest facility is Sandy Ridge Wind 2, Llc at 87 MW. Data comes from EIA Form 860, EIA Form 923, and EPA eGRID federal releases.
